Chinese Cresteds: A Look at the Powderpuff and Hairless Varieties

The Chinese Crested is definitely a unique breed, with two distinct varieties: the adorable Powderpuff and the striking Hairless. Although both share the same personality traits, their appearances are quite diverse. The Powderpuff is covered in abundant fur, resembling a delicate cloud. In contrast, the Hairless variety boasts smooth, leathery skin with just tufts of hair on its head, feet, and tail, giving it an almost otherworldly look.

An Introduction to the Unusual Chinese Crested Dog Breed

The Chinese Crested dog breed is a truly remarkable breed known for its distinct style. These charming dogs come in two varieties: the powderpuff, which has a abundant coat of hair, and the hairless, which as its name suggests, lacks fur except for tufts on the head, tail, and feet.

Despite their unusual looks, Chinese Crested dogs are affectionate companions who thrive on human attention. They are known for being intelligent, energetic, and versatile, making them a great fit for a variety of living situations.

  • Grooming a Chinese Crested is relatively straightforward.
  • They require regular cleansing, and the powderpuff variety needs to be brushed regularly to prevent mats.
  • The hairless variety benefits from UV protection when exposed to direct sunlight.
